☐ Verify rate limiting on Gatewick internal gateway before cutover. Confirm the per-team token buckets match the approved quota sheet, and that burst allowance is capped at twice steady-state. Run the soak script against staging for fifteen minutes and check for spurious 429s. Record the verification build using the token below.

pipeline stamp: htk31_f769b577b3028a4e9958e5bb8d1259a

## Deployment

So you've written a plugin for Rankpetal and want to test it against the relevance tuning notes service — nice. Deploy is just a container push plus a registry entry; the tuner picks up plugins on restart, no hot reload yet (sorry). Make sure your plugin tolerates the default scoring weights. The service ships with the following configuration out of the box.

config for yajep-tafof:
[rusath]
team = julmir
access_code = ac_fe37fd
host = rusath.novactech.test
port = 8000
owner = pelmir.weneth
peer = oliwyn.olvarqdyn.internal

- [ ] Key ceremony step 7 (Pixelmill resize CLI): before sealing the signing key for the `pxm-batch` release pipeline, verify the checksum of the batch-resize binary on the air-gapped workstation and have both witnesses initial the log. Once Marta confirms the tamper seal, record the recovery passphrase shown below.

unlock words, hahip-baduf: holwyn-istath-julvan

Runbook: Lexiply string extraction. Run extract-strings nightly via the Cartwheel scheduler. Script reads only from the templates tree; it must never receive repo write tokens. Output goes to the staging bucket, reviewed before merge. Flag any diff touching interpolation markers. Escalation path and sandbox constraints for the extractor are described on the internal page here.

operations page: https://jira.qorvelsys.internal/browse/pages/browse/pages

## Authentication

Quick context for the weekly sync: as part of the Hermetica migration, our builds no longer phone home to random mirrors — everything resolves through the Cobblevault artifact proxy. That means the old netrc hack is dead (good riddance). Each build sandbox now authenticates to Cobblevault once at startup, and dependency fetches are fully pinned and reproducible after that. For local testing of the hermetic toolchain, the proxy expects this key:

gateway credential: kto23_dolYgAScEh2TaPOlStqOl98